S U C C E S~S OF THE INCANDESCENT Gas Light. LOCAL TESTIMONIALS. Blenheim, August 6th, 1895. 0 J. W. Griffiths, Esq., Blenheim. Dear Sir, — We have much pleasure m informing you that the Incandescent Light plaoed m our chop has given us every datisfaotion, as, besides considerably reduoing the heat, it has proved a saving m lighting acoount of about 50 per cent. Yours faithfully, SMALE & HAT. Blenheim, 6th August, 1895. C. J. W. Gbiffiihs, Eeq , Blenheim. Dear Sir,— The Inoandesoeot Light Burners plaoed m my printing room have proved a splendid success, as, besides giving a much better light, they have reduoed my gas acoount by over 50 per cent., the last two months' figures being June £6 Us, July £2 19s.
